What is a Customer Experience Reference Architecture?  

Creating and deploying a customer experience reference architecture is tricky, but microsegmentation can drastically increase the chances of success 

Customer experience reference architecture is the structured framework or model that provides guidance to organizations on best practices for designing and delivering a consistent and excellent customer experience across all touchpoints and interactions with their company or brand. This architecture outlines the essential components, processes, and technologies required for seamless and positive customer experiences at every stage of their relationship with an organization. 

A customer experience reference architecture helps align an organization’s strategies, processes, and technologies with activities to create a true customer-centric environment. An organization that uses the architecture successfully establishes a holistic view of the customer journey, identifies pain points and opportunities for improvement, and enables better decision-making; all to optimize customer satisfaction and loyalty.

There are half-dozen “must have” components to any customer experience reference architecture, so let’s take a closer look at the security issues that threaten their validity as valuable tools and learn how microsegmentation can help overcome these challenges. 

Six critical components of a successful customer experience reference architecture 

  1. Customer data management 
    Full data visibility throughout an organization means far fewer nasty surprises and threats to the customer experience across the board. A successful customer experience reference architecture should detail how customer data is collected, stored, and managed and account for a single customer view across various touchpoints while ensuring data privacy and security.
  2. Customer experience mapping 
    Showing how a real person journeys through your customer experience helps identify and provide ongoing evaluation of critical touchpoints and interactions. This process allows businesses to optimize each touchpoint and create a consistent experience throughout the entire customer lifecycle. 
  3. Omnichannel integration 
    An effective customer experience architecture should integrate all relevant communication channels (e.g., website, mobile app, social media, call centers) to provide a seamless experience as customers move between channels.
  4. Personalization and recommendation engines
    Utilizing customer data, the architecture should support personalized experiences and make recommendations based on customers’ preferences, behavior, and history.
  5. Customer feedback and analytics loop 
    The architecture should include mechanisms to gather customer feedback and analyze behavior on the journey. The insights gained will help drive improvements in customer service and inform strategic decisions. You should even gather intelligence on the feedback mechanisms themselves.
  6. Employee experience feedback loop
    Recognizing the link between employee experiences and customer experiences, the architecture may also encompass elements to enhance the engagement and empowerment of employees in delivering exceptional customer experiences. 

Factors that hinder the deployment of a customer experience reference architecture 

While all these components are critical to creating and deploying a customer experience reference architecture that can enhance customer engagement and satisfaction, they can also be vulnerable to security issues that may impact the overall customer experience.  Here some of the common security issues that may impact the validity of your architecture: 

  1. Data breaches
    The platform that informs a customer experience reference architecture handles a high volume of sensitive data and the personally identifiable information of most (if not all) customers; including preferences and behavior patterns. A data breach that results in unauthorized access to this data could lead to identity theft, financial fraud, and loss of customer trust.
  2. Insufficient identity and access management (IAM) policies and processes
    Malicious attackers looking to gain unauthorized access to customer data and administrative functionalities can exploit weak or misconfigured user accounts to achieve their goals. Poor IAM practices can leading to account misuse, takeovers and widespread data manipulation that can impact a customer experience reference architecture. 
  3. Cross-site scripting (XSS) and injection attacks
    Here cybercriminals exploit undetected or unfixed vulnerabilities in web applications to inject malicious scripts or code into the platform, compromising customer data and potentially delivering malicious content to customers.
  4. Denial of Service (DoS) and Distributed Denial of Service (DDoS) attacks
    In these attacks, hackers overwhelm the customer experience platform with excessive traffic, making it inaccessible to legitimate users and affecting customer interactions.
  5. API vulnerabilities
    Customer experience platforms often rely on APIs (Application Programming Interfaces) to connect with various systems and services. Inadequate authentication and authorization mechanisms in APIs can lead to unauthorized access and data leaks.
  6. Insecure mobile applications
    If the customer experience platform includes mobile applications, security vulnerabilities in these apps can expose customer data and activities to potential attackers.
  7. Inadequate encryption and data protection
    Customer data should be encrypted both in transit and at rest. Failure to implement proper encryption measures can lead to data exposure and unauthorized access.
  8. Insider threats
    Internal employees or contractors with access to the customer experience platform may intentionally or unintentionally misuse customer data, compromising privacy and trust.
  9. Compliance and regulatory issues
    Failure to comply with industry-specific regulations (e.g., GDPR, NIS2, PCI-DSS) regarding data privacy and protection can result in legal repercussions and damage to the organization’s reputation. 

To mitigate these security issues, organizations should implement robust security measures, conduct regular security assessments and audits, monitor and analyze system logs for suspicious activities, and keep up to date with security best practices and technologies. Regular security training and awareness programs for employees and customers can also help strengthen the overall security posture of the customer experience reference architecture. 

The role of microsegmentation in a customer experience reference architecture  

Microsegmentation can also play a significant role in the success of a customer experience reference architecture. Here’s how:  

  • Microsegmentation divides the network and infrastructure into smaller, more granular, isolated segments based on various factors like user roles, applications, and data types. This enables you to establish strict access controls, reduce the attack surface and mitigate the impact of security breaches. This process builds trust with customers with regard to safeguarding their sensitive information. 
  • Microsegmenting customer data and behavior enables organizations to gain deeper insights into individual preferences, interests, and needs and leverage it to create personalized offers, product recommendations, and targeted marketing campaigns, ultimately leading to higher customer engagement and loyalty. 
  • By analyzing the behavior and preferences of each segment, organizations can optimize the customer journey; providing the right content, assistance, and touchpoints at the right time, leading to smoother and more satisfying customer interactions. 
  • As the customer base grows and changes, microsegmentation provides a scalable approach to managing customer data and interactions. By having granular control over customer segments, the architecture can adapt to new customer requirements and emerging market trends quickly and efficiently.
  • Microsegmentation enables real-time analysis of customer interactions and behavior. By processing data at a fine-grained level, organizations can make instant decisions on how to respond to customer actions, such as offering personalized discounts or resolving issues promptly, resulting in improved customer satisfaction.
  • Microsegmentation can integrate a customer experience reference architecture with other systems like customer relationship management (CRM), marketing automation, and analytics platforms to facilitate seamless data flow between systems and enable a comprehensive and unified view of the customer across the organization. 
  • By restricting access to specific segments and data, organizations can ensure they are in compliance with relevant data protection laws.
